Mercedes-Benz Restoration Considerations

Every Mercedes-Benz restoration project is unique. Some can be more challenging than others. The condition and service history of your vehicle can have a significant impact on the time and cost of restoration.

Several factors can influence your Mercedes restoration costs and budget:

  • the year, model, and condition of your Mercedes
  • your restoration goals (customize, sell, show, exhibition, etc.)
  • availability of replacement parts vs. fabrication needs

Market Value Factors

Our team understands that a car’s market value is a factor in any restoration project. For example, restoration of a 2-door, mid-1980s Mercedes 500 SL in fair to good condition might be equal to or higher than a car’s current market value.  These can also be true for other models like the 300 SDL and 450 SL depending on the specific trim and configuration.

A model like the 190 SL and 280 SL and may require similar levels of repair. However, because these models often have a higher market value, owners find it easier to make the investment in a restoration of the quality we provide.

Rare and vintage Mercedes like the 300 SL convertible and gullwing hardtop cars are often restored for private collections, auctions, or museum placements. Even though their age and condition can result in higher restoration costs, a concourse quality restoration can increase the car’s overall value and desirability.

We also understand that market value is not the only factor. We’ve met a lot of Mercedes-Benz owners through the years and know that other factors are also important. Those range from reclaiming a piece of family history to a deep appreciation for the classic art form these iconic luxury vehicles represent.
